Baking soda paste method for dirty oven glass

The baking soda paste method works because baking soda is mildly abrasive yet gentle enough for glass surfaces. By mixing baking soda with a small amount of water, you create a spreadable paste that clings to grease stains. Once applied, it slowly breaks down buildup without scratching. The real magic happens when you let it sit, allowing natural grease breakdown to occur. This approach avoids harsh chemical fumes, making it ideal for enclosed kitchens. How to apply the oven glass cleaning trick correctly

To get the best results, application matters just as much as the ingredients. Start by spreading the paste evenly across the glass, focusing on darker areas. Let it rest for at least 20โ€“30 minutes so the baking soda can work through the residue. Gentle wiping with a damp cloth then reveals streak free finish without heavy scrubbing. For older ovens, repeating the process helps achieve long lasting shine. This method is valued for its simple home solution feel and offers time saving cleanup for everyday cooks.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Can baking soda scratch oven glass?

No, when mixed into a paste and wiped gently, it is safe for glass.

2. How long should the paste sit on the glass?

Let it sit for 20โ€“30 minutes for best grease removal.

3. Is this method safe for daily use?

Yes, it is mild enough for regular maintenance cleaning.

4. Will it remove very old stains?

Old stains may need repeated applications for full clarity.
